

Using this shield as a guide, I'd make the larger cortosis shield give the same deflection bonus but without the extra talent (and keep the armor proficiency requirement, possibly bumping it up to Medium to match the cortosis gauntlet), in exchange for explicitly taking up the hand using the shield (the shield gauntlet doesn't). There's also the Kilian Ranger energy shield-gauntlet in the Rebellion Era book, which is a buckler-like energy shield that requires a talent to get a +2 deflection bonus once per turn essentially against an attack that you're allowed a dodge bonus against (aware of the attack, not flat-footed), as well as armor proficiency to use the thing. In Star Wars, it's of course mostly a small energy field, so the cost of an all-metal shield would be higher than the given 500 credits. Provides a +5 cover bonus when fighting defensively, and is about a meter by half a meter in size. There are rules for a riot shield on page 77 of Threats of the Galaxy.
